Stored procedure là gì?
Stored procedure là tập hợp các câu lệnh SQL được lưu trữ và thực thi trong cơ sở dữ liệu. Nó giống như một hàm (function) hoặc phương thức (method) trong lập trình, cho phép lập trình viên gọi đến thực thi một tác vụ nào đó trong cơ sở dữ liệu.
Đặc điểm của stored procedure
Một số đặc điểm nổi bật của stored procedure:
- Được lưu trữ và thực thi trong cơ sở dữ liệu, không cần phải viết lại mỗi lần sử dụng
- Tăng hiệu suất và performance hệ thống nhờ việc chỉ cần gọi đến mà không cần biên dịch lại
- Tái sử dụng code, giảm thiểu sai sót logic
- Dễ quản lý và bảo trì hệ thống
- Đảm bảo tính bảo mật và toàn vẹn dữ liệu
Cách sử dụng stored procedure
Để sử dụng stored procedure, ta cần thực hiện các bước sau:
- Tạo stored procedure bằng câu lệnh CREATE PROCEDURE
- Sử dụng stored procedure thông qua câu lệnh CALL hoặc EXECUTE
- Chỉnh sửa tham số đầu vào của stored procedure khi cần (nếu có)
Ví dụ: Tạo một stored procedure đơn giản để lấy tất cả dữ liệu từ bảng Customers
CREATE PROCEDURE get_Customers AS BEGIN SELECT * FROM Customers END
Để gọi đến stored procedure trên, dùng câu lệnh:
EXEC get_Customers
Ưu điểm của việc sử dụng stored procedure
Sử dụng stored procedure có một số ưu điểm sau:
- Tối ưu hiệu năng: Thực thi nhanh hơn so với câu lệnh SQL thông thường
- Giảm thiểu lưu lượng mạng: Chỉ cần truyền tải câu lệnh gọi stored procedure qua mạng thay vì toàn bộ câu lệnh SQL.
- Tái sử dụng code: Giảm sai sót logic và dễ bảo trì, nâng cấp.
- Đảm bảo tính toàn vẹn dữ liệu
Như vậy, stored procedure là công cụ hữu ích giúp quản trị và sử dụng cơ sở dữ liệu hiệu quả. Hy vọng bài viết đã phần nào giải đáp thắc mắc "stored procedure là gì" cũng như hướng dẫn cách sử dụng chúng.
Tìm hiểu & tham khảo về Stored Procedure Là Gì
Stored Procedure là gì? Cách viết và sử dụng Stored Procedures hiện nay ...
Stored Procedure là một tập hợp những câu lệnh SQL sử dụng để thực hiện một nhiệm vụ nhất định. Nó hoạt động giống như một hàm tại những phương ngữ lập trình khác. Stored procedure là một định nghĩa k>
https://coder.com.vn/stored-procedure-la-gi
Giới Thiệu Tổng Quan Stored Procedure Là Gì Trong SQL Server
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ored procedure lần đầu tiên thì SQL Server>
https://www.semtek.com.vn/procedure-la-gi
Giới thiệu Stored Procedure trong SQL Server - Freetuts
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ored procedure lần đầu tiên thì SQL Server>
https://freetuts.net/gioi-thieu-stored-procedure-trong-sql-server-1609.html
MySQL: Stored Procedure là gì?
Stored Procedure là một tập hợp các câu lệnh SQL dùng để thực thi một nhiệm vụ nhất định. Nó hoạt động giống như một hàm trong các ngôn ngữ lập trình khác. Stored procedure là một khái niệm khá phổ bi>
https://www.codehub.com.vn/MySQL-Stored-Procedure-la-gi
Stored Procedure Là Gì ? Định Nghĩa Và Giải Thích Ý Nghĩa Stored ...
Aug 3, 2021Stored procedure trong SQL Server được sử dụng để nhóm một hoặc nhiều câu lệnh Transact-SQL thành các đơn vị logic. Stored procedure được lưu trữ dưới dạng các đối tượng được đặt tên trong>
https://timhome.vn/stored-procedure-la-gi
Stored Procedures là gì, cách viết và sử dụng Stored Procedures?
Jan 10, 2021Stored Procedure là một nhóm câu lệnh Transact-SQL đã được compiled (biên dịch) và chứa trong SQL Server dưới một tên nào đó và được xử lý như một đơn vị (chứ không phải nhiều câu SQL riên>
https://chiasethongtin.com/group/bai-viet/stored-procedures-la-gi-cach-viet-va-su-dung-stored-procedures-13800-1.html
Stored procedure - Là cái gì vậy
Stored procedure cho phép chúng ta truyền tham số cụ thể để tùy biến nội dung sql của mình. Giống như khai báo function vậy : getUser (id) chẳng hạn. Một điều nữa là ta có thể gọi Stored procedure xxx>
https://viblo.asia/p/stored-procedure-la-cai-gi-vay-924lJJXYlPM
Giới thiệu Stored Procedure trong SQL Server
Một Stored Procedure là bao gồm các câu lệnh Transact-SQL và được lưu lại trong cơ sở dữ liệu. Các lập trình viên chỉ cần gọi ra và thực thi thông qua SQL Server Management Studio hoặc ngay trong ứng>
https://viblo.asia/p/gioi-thieu-stored-procedure-trong-sql-server-m68Z0VpM5kG
Stored procedure - Là cái gì vậy ? - Trang Chủ
Stored procedure cho phép chúng ta truyền tham số cụ thể để tùy biến nội dung sql của mình. Giống như khai báo function vậy : getUser (id) chẳng hạn. Một điều nữa là ta có thể gọi Stored procedure xxx>
https://itzone.com.vn/vi/article/stored-procedure-la-cai-gi-vay
Stored Procedure trong SQL Server | Comdy
Kết quả của stored procedure là như nhau tuy nhiên câu lệnh sẽ rõ ràng hơn. Tham số kiểu chuỗi ký tự cho stored procedure trong SQL Server. ... CURSOR là gì? CURSOR (con trỏ) là một đối tượng cho phép>
https://comdy.vn/sql-server/stored-procedure-trong-sql-server
Giới Thiệu Stored Procedure Sql Là Gì, Cách Viết Và Sử Dụng Stored ...
May 18, 2021Stored procedure trong Squốc lộ Server được sử dụng để nhóm một hoặc các câu lệnh Transact-Squốc lộ thành các đơn vị chức năng xúc tích. Stored procedure được lưu trữ bên dưới dạng những đ>
https://ttmn.mobi/stored-procedure-sql-la-gi
Giới thiệu Mysql Stored Procedure là gì? - Freetuts
Với MYSQL thì khái niệm Stored Procedure chỉ được thêm vào kể từ Version 5 với mục đích là giúp việc xử lý dữ liệu linh hoạt và mạnh mẽ hơn. 2. Ưu điểm của Stored Proccedure trong Mysql Thông thường c>
https://freetuts.net/gioi-thieu-mysql-stored-procedure-la-gi-299.html
Stored Procedure Sql Là Gì, Stored Procedure Trong Sql Server
Bạn đang xem: Stored Procedure Sql Là Gì, Stored Procedure Trong Sql Server tại thcslongan.edu.vn Stored procedure trong SQL Server được sử dụng để nhóm một hoặc nhiều câu lệnh Transact-SQL thành các>
https://thcslongan.edu.vn/stored-procedure-sql-la-gi-stored-procedure-trong-sql-server
Stored Procedure Sql Là Gì ? Stored Procedure Trong Sql Server
Aug 20, 2021Stored procedure trong SQL Server được thực hiện để nhóm một hoặc các câu lệnh Transact-Squốc lộ thành các đơn vị súc tích. Stored procedure được lưu trữ bên dưới dạng những đối tượng ngườ>
https://hoidapthutuchaiquan.vn/stored-procedure-sql-la-gi
Các khái niệm về stored procedure
Các khái niệm về stored procedure. SQL được thiết kế và cài đặt như là một ngôn ngữ để thực hiện các thao tác trên cơ sở dữ liệu như tạo lập các cấu trúc trong cơ sở dữ liệu, bổ sung, cập nhật, xoá và>
https://expressmagazine.net/development/1492/cac-khai-niem-ve-stored-procedure
Stored Procedure Là Gì - Giới Thiệu Stored Procedure Trong Sql Server ...
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ored procedure lần đầu tiên thì SQL Server>
https://thienmaonline.vn/stored-procedure-la-gi
Giới thiệu Stored Procedure trong SQL Server
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ored procedure lần đầu tiên thì SQL Server>
https://pokimobile.vn/stored-procedure-la-gi-1638524211
Stored procedure là gì
Bạn đang xem: Stored procedure là gì.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ored>
https://licadho.org/stored-procedure-la-gi
Stored Procedure Sql Là Gì, Stored Procedure Trong Sql Server
Aug 19, 2022Stored Procedure Sql Là Gì, Stored Procedure Trong Sql Server Stored procedure trong SQL Server được cần sử dụng để nhóm một hoặc nhiều câu lệnh Transact-SQL thành các đơn vị, xúc tích. St>
https://hethongbokhoe.com/stored-procedure-sql-la-gi-stored-procedure-trong-sql-server
Gioi thieu tong quan Stored Procedure la gi trong SQL Server
Stored procedure là gì? Trong bài này bạn sẽ được tìm hiểu khái niệm về stored procedure trong SQL Server, qua đó bạn sẽ biết được cách tạo mới, thực thi, thay đổi và xóa stored procedure. Stored…>
https://semtekcorp.medium.com/gioi-thieu-tong-quan-stored-procedure-la-gi-trong-sql-server-27b2d011351f
Stored Procedure là gì? Định nghĩa và giải thích ý nghĩa
Định nghĩa Stored Procedure là gì? Stored Procedure là Stored Procedure.Đây là nghĩa tiếng Việt của thuật ngữ Stored Procedure - một thuật ngữ thuộc nhóm Technology Terms - Công nghệ thông tin.. Một t>
https://filegi.com/tech-term/stored-procedure-585
Procedure Trong Sql Là Gì - Mysql: Stored Procedure Là Gì
Hướng dẫn tạo Stored Procedure trong SQL Server - Yêu cầu Câu 1. Tạo stored procedure dùng để thêm dữ liệu vào bảng KHOA Câu 2. Tạo stored procedure dùng để thêm dữ liệu vào bảng LOP Câu 3. Tạo stored>
https://tranminhdung.vn/procedure-trong-sql-la-gi
Stored Procedure Sql Là Gì, Stored Procedure Trong Sql Server
Stored procedure được lưu trữ dưới dạng các đối tượng được đặt tên trong máy chủ cơ sở dữ liệu SQL Server. Đang xem: Stored procedure sql là gì. Khi bạn gọi một stored procedure lần đầu tiên, SQL Serv>
https://thienmaonline.vn/stored-procedure-sql-la-gi
Cách tạo Stored Procedure trong SQL Server đơn giản
Stored Procedure là gì? Một stored procedure SQL (viết tắt là SP) là một bộ sưu tập các câu lệnh SQL và các logic lệnh SQL được biên dịch và lưu trữ trong cơ sở dữ liệu. Stored procedures trong SQL ch>
https://vietgiatrang.com/cach-tao-stored-procedure-trong-sql-server
Cách tạo Stored Procedure trong SQL Server đơn giản
Stored Procedure là gì? Một stored procedure SQL ( viết tắt là SP ) là một bộ sưu tập những câu lệnh SQL và những logic lệnh SQL được biên dịch và tàng trữ trong cơ sở tài liệu. Stored procedures tron>
https://final-blade.com/store-procedure-trong-sql-server-1646913632
Stored Procedure trong MySQL - Học Spring MVC
Stored Procedure được cung cấp bởi hệ quản trị cơ sở dữ liệu, được biên dịch và lưu lại 1 lần duy nhất, được gọi đến và thao tác trực tiếp bởi hệ quản trị cơ sở dữ liệu đó. Vì vậy, hiệu năng đạt được>
https://hocspringmvc.net/stored-procedure-trong-mysql
Giới thiệu Stored Procedure trong SQL Server - SQL Server nâng cao
Apr 6, 2021Stored procedure là tập hợp một hoặc nhiều câu lệnh T-SQL thành một nhóm đơn vị xử lý logic và được lưu trữ trên Database Server. Khi một câu lệnh gọi chạy stored procedure lần đầu tiên thì>
https://code24h.com/gioi-thieu-stored-procedure-trong-sql-server-sql-server-nang-cao-d42844.htm
Giới Thiệu Stored Procedure Là Gì Trong Sql Server, Giới Thiệu Stored ...
Jun 30, 2021Stored procedure là gì? Trong bài xích này bạn sẽ được tìm hiểu quan niệm về stored procedure trong SQL Server, thông qua đó bạn sẽ hiểu rằng biện pháp tạo bắt đầu, thực thi, thay đổi và x>
https://xemlienminh360.net/stored-procedure-la-gi
Giới thiệu Mysql Stored Procedure là gì? - MySQL nâng cao
Apr 6, 2021Qua bài này hy vọng bạn hiểu Stored Procedure trong MYSQL là gì và ưu nhược điểm của nó. Chính vì những nhược điểm đó mà Procedure rất ít khi sử dụng trong các ứng dụng Website. Giả sử bạn>
https://code24h.com/gioi-thieu-mysql-stored-procedure-la-gi-mysql-nang-cao-d42637.htm